At its core, roulette is straightforward. Players place bets on numbers, colors, or groups on the betting table. The dealer spins the wheel, drops the ball, and whichever pocket it lands in determines the outcome. The beauty lies in the wide variety of bets, from even-money wagers like red/black or odd/even to riskier choices like single numbers that pay 35 to 1. This flexibility allows players to tailor their strategies to their comfort level.

There are two main versions: European and American roulette. European wheels have 37 pockets (numbers 1–36 and a single zero), while American wheels add a double zero, making 38 pockets. The extra slot increases the house edge, which is why European roulette is often preferred. Some casinos also offer French roulette, which includes special rules like “La Partage,” giving players back half their bet if the ball lands on zero, further improving the odds.

Roulette’s enduring popularity comes partly from its universal appeal. Unlike poker or blackjack, no skill or strategy is required beyond choosing bets. Anyone can join the table, making it an inclusive game that fits both high-rollers and casual players. The suspense as the ball circles the wheel, slowing before it lands, creates a thrill that keeps players coming back.

That said, players often adopt betting systems in hopes of improving results. Strategies like the Martingale, where bets are doubled after each loss, or the Fibonacci sequence, are commonly tried. While these systems can create short-term excitement, they cannot overcome the house edge in the long run. Roulette remains a game of chance, and its unpredictability is exactly what makes it so captivating.

The rise of online casinos has given roulette a new stage. Digital versions allow players to enjoy the game instantly, while live dealer roulette streams the wheel in real time, combining convenience with authentic atmosphere. Mobile apps make it even easier, offering quick spins on the go. Some online platforms add modern twists, like multi-wheel roulette or speed roulette, to enhance variety.
